How To Choose The Best Blemish Cream
Not all blemish creams are created equal. The wrong choice can leave you with a dry, irritated face that still has pimples. Here are the specific factors that determine whether a cream actually clears your skin or just creates new problems.
Active Ingredient: Salicylic Acid vs. Benzoyl Peroxide
Salicylic acid (0.5%–2%) is a beta hydroxy acid that dissolves oil and dead skin inside the pore, making it ideal for blackheads, whiteheads, and inflamed pimples. Benzoyl peroxide (2.5%–10%) kills acne-causing bacteria and is better for inflammatory, cystic breakouts. Benzoyl peroxide can bleach fabrics and cause more dryness, so match the ingredient to your breakout type.
Concentration and pH Balance
A 2% salicylic acid formula is more effective than 1.5% for stubborn clogs, but it can cause stinging if the pH is too low. Look for pH ranges between 5.0 and 6.0, especially if you have sensitive skin. Maximum-strength benzoyl peroxide (10%) works fast but is harsh on dry or eczema-prone skin—consider starting with a lower concentration if you’re new to it.
Additional Skin-Soothing Ingredients
The best blemish creams don’t just attack acne—they support recovery. Ingredients like niacinamide, tea tree oil, witch hazel, and chamomile reduce redness, calm inflammation, and help prevent post-acne marks. A formula that only strips oil without soothing will compromise your barrier over time.
